Paleokarst breccias are a common feature of sedimentary rift basins. The Billefjorden Trough in the high Arctic archipelago of Svalbard is an example of such a rift. Here the Carboniferous stratigraphy exhibits intervals of paleokarst breccias formed by gypsum dissolution. In this study we integrate digital outcrop models (DOMs) with a 2D ground pe...

Fortet is one of several Carboniferous paleokarst-breccia outcrops located in Billefjorden and is the type locality for the Fortet Member of the Minkinfjellet Formation. These breccias developed in the Carboniferous Billefjorden Trough, a North-South trending rift stretching through the entire island of Spitsbergen. Syn-rift deposits of this rift a...
